#e695dd h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e695dd is composed of 90.2% red, 58.4%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.2%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 306.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 74.3%. #e695d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d2bbb.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

● #e695dd color description : Very soft magenta.
The hexadecimal color #e695dd has RGB values of R:230, G:149,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.04,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15111645.
